Succeeding in Algebra
Mathematics has many branches and algebra is one of the most stressed subdivisions which studies structure, relation and quantity. Numbers, symbols, elements, and variables are all within the domain of algebra. Students are presented primary concepts and methodologies of resolving equations in elementary algebra like solving radical equations, understanding polynomials along with factoring binomials, trinomials and polynomials as well as the determination of their roots.
Linear equations are the simplest to resolve. Simultaneous equations with two or three variables is an extension of linear equations. As we progress further in the sequence to quadratic, bi-quadratic and cubic equations , they get more and more complicated to solve.
The sources of Algebra
Elementary algebra constitutes the intermediate or college algebra. Apart from covering mathematical expressions, it also contains of all forms of equations like linear , quadratic and cubic. All geometric shapes such as circle, hyperbola, and parabola can be described as equations.
The equations can be solved to get a graph. Lines are the product of graphing simple linear equations. It is quite easy to solve systems of equations when presented graphically. Two or more equations with the same number of variables are usually described as a system of equations. They can be both linear and non-linear. Systems of equations with inequalities (example; x>y) when graphed gives an region on the graph which matches the inequality condition.
Matrices aid find solution to a plenty of complicated problems like the ones existing in electrical networks. A matrix is a rectangular range of numbers presented in rows and columns. The numbers in a matrix are known as entries. Various functions like addition, multiplication and decomposition can be performed on matrices thereby providing realistic solutions for theoretical questions.
